In georgia who is most responsibilite for making the laws of state

1 Answer

1 vote

Answer:

the General Assembly

Step-by-step explanation:

Georgia's legislative branch is called the General Assembly. Georgia has had a two house legislature since 1777, when the first state constitution was created. Today those two houses are called the House of Representatives and the Senate. The purpose of the General Assembly is to make laws.
